Ex-Claret Akinbiyi in court on driving charge

Former Clarets striker Ade Akinbiyi has been fined for driving an uninsured car filled with too many passengers.

Akinbiyi (40), who is now player coach at Colwyn Bay, was caught driving five adults and a child inside an Audi A5 on the A55 in North Wales.

The former Leicester City and Burnley front man was convicted of carrying passengers in a manner likely to cause danger and having no insurance.

Flintshire magistrates fined him £1,000 with £145 costs and six points were put on his driving licence.

Akinbiyi, of Dutton, Warrington, did not attend the hearing in Mold, but magistrates were told he was stopped on October 25th last year near Bodelwyddan, Denbighshire.

There were four other adults and a child in the Audi A5.
